Abstract

See full text

Systems for analyzing target materials of a suspension include a tube and a float in which at least a portion of the float is porous. The at least one pore can allow for the flow of fluids and reagents out of the float and into a space between the outer surface of the float and the inner surface of the tube. The at least one pore can also prevent unwanted particles or material from flowing into the float. The introduction of additional fluids, such as fixing agents, washing agents, detergents, or labeling agents, may aid in further processing or detection of the target analyte. The porosity of the float may also allow for the target analyte to be extracted through the float by introducing a removal device, such as a vacuum, to draw the target analyte through the float and into the vacuum.
